S42.473G
ICD-10-CMDisplaced transcondylar fracture of unspecified humerus, subsequent encounter for fracture with delayed healing
This code signifies a fracture that has occurred across the condyles of the humerus, where the bone fragments are no longer in their normal anatomical alignment. The "subsequent encounter" indicates the patient is receiving ongoing care for this injury, and "delayed healing" specifies that the fracture is not mending at the expected rate.
Use this code for follow-up visits where a patient with a previously diagnosed displaced transcondylar humerus fracture is being managed for slow or stalled bone healing. This includes scenarios such as cast changes, physical therapy evaluations, or imaging to assess healing progress when the fracture is not uniting as anticipated.
